Description
Dorsally, the posterior (extensor) compartment of the male antebrachium is presented from an external back view, with the superficial extensor muscle bellies tapering distally into long tendons as they approach the wrist. Extensor carpi radialis longus and brevis occupy the lateral (radial) side, while extensor digitorum sits more centrally with its tendinous slips aligned in parallel toward the dorsum of the hand. Medially (ulnar side), extensor carpi ulnaris forms a distinct border along the posterior ulna, and the proximal mass of brachioradialis can be appreciated anterolaterally as it frames the extensor group. This dorsal arrangement matters when teaching tendon topography and diagnosing overuse syndromes around the distal forearm and wrist, where pain localizes to specific extensor tendons under the extensor retinaculum. Intersection syndrome, for example, occurs where the tendons of abductor pollicis longus and extensor pollicis brevis cross the extensor carpi radialis longus and brevis in the distal dorsal forearm, while lateral epicondylalgia often reflects pathology at the common extensor origin proximally. Surface landmarks guide procedures too. Palpation and ultrasound tracing of extensor carpi ulnaris along the ulnar groove can help confirm subsheath injury in ulnar-sided wrist pain.
